RSU Choir to Present Spring Concert April 30

The Rogers State University Choir will present its spring concert at 7:30 p.m., Tuesday, April 30, in the Baird Hall Performance Studio on the RSU campus in Claremore.

Members of the University Choir will perform a variety of pieces during the event, which will be free and open to the public.

The University Choir will be performing a selection of works that include “Americana Jubilee,” “Hallelujah” by Ludwig van Beethoven, “Libera me,” “Caro mio ben,” John Denver’s “Sunshine on my Shoulders,” “Where E’er You Walk” by George Frideric Handel, “As I Hear the Sweet Lark Sing,” “Take, O, Take Those Lips Away,” “Yesterday” by John Lennon and Paul McCartney and “Festival Sanctus.”

RSU musical groups are open to RSU students, as well as members of the community.
